Technical Field
The utility model belongs to the technical field of medical appliances, and particularly relates to an anti-scalding barrier moxibustion tool.
Background
The moxibustion technique is an indirect moxibustion technique among moxa cone moxibustion techniques, and comprises fixing moxa sticks (with a diameter of 18mm at the bottom and a height of 30mm at the bottom, and a diameter of 30mm at the bottom and a height of 30 mm) in a moxibustion tool, igniting, and then applying the moxibustion to acupoints. The method uses the effects of warm heat and medicines to achieve the purposes of preventing and protecting health, treating diseases and strengthening body by meridian conduction, warming and activating meridian, harmonizing qi and blood, detumescence and resolving hard mass, eliminating dampness and dispelling cold, and restoring yang and rescuing the adverse qi.
However, when the barrier moxibustion tool is used, smoke generated after moxa sticks are ignited can escape to the outside, so that smoke in a ward is choked, and the smoke can enter the respiratory tract along with the respiration of a person, thereby causing damage to the body of the person.
Disclosure of Invention
The purpose of the utility model is that: aims to provide an anti-scalding barrier moxibustion tool which is used for solving the problem that smoke generated after moxa sticks are ignited can escape to the outer side, so that smoke in a ward is wound, and the smoke can enter a respiratory tract along with the respiration of a person to cause damage to the body of the person.
In order to achieve the technical purpose, the utility model adopts the following technical scheme:

Further limiting, a plurality of suckers are uniformly and fixedly arranged at the lower end of the cylinder. By means of the structural design, the sucker is extruded downwards through the cylinder body, when air in the sucker is discharged, the sucker clings to the skin of a patient under the action of pressure, and the cylinder body is prevented from moving in the process of barrier moxibustion.
Further defined, spun yarn fireproof cloth is arranged in the cylinder body. According to the structural design, the spun yarn fireproof cloth is arranged, so that ash generated after the moxa cone burns is blocked, and the ash is prevented from falling downwards and contacting with the skin of a patient to cause scalding.
Further limited, the upper end cover of barrel is equipped with the silk cover, fixed mounting has the connecting cylinder on the top cap, the inside of connecting cylinder is equipped with the internal thread, connecting cylinder and silk cover threaded connection, the top of top cap rotates installs the handle. By means of the structural design, the connecting cylinder and the wire sleeve are in threaded connection, so that the top cover can be detached from the cylinder body, and a user can conveniently fix and ignite the moxa cone.
Further limited, the barrier layer includes puts thing dish and push-and-pull piece, the spout has transversely been seted up to the lower part of barrel, put thing dish slidable mounting in the spout, it comprises the fixed frame of slip in the spout and the fixed network of placing the medicine to put the thing dish, push-and-pull piece fixed mounting is on the fixed frame. By means of the structural design, the storage disc can be pulled out or pushed into the cylinder body through the push-pull block, and a doctor can conveniently replace or add medicines.
Further limited, fixed column is fixed on the cylinder, rotate the strip of installing on the fixed column, rotate the strip and put thing dish contact. After the storage tray is pushed into the cylinder, the rotating strip can generate an interference effect on the storage tray, so that the storage tray is prevented from sliding out of the cylinder and influencing use.
Further limiting, the smoke discharging mechanism comprises a movable iron cover, a smoke discharging pipe, a bell mouth and a fan, wherein a round hole is formed in the top of the top cover, an annular magnet is fixedly arranged at the top of the top cover and located right above the round hole, the movable iron cover is movably arranged on the annular magnet, the smoke discharging pipe is fixedly arranged on the movable iron cover, the smoke discharging pipe is communicated with the movable iron cover, the bell mouth is fixedly arranged at one end, far away from the movable iron cover, of the smoke discharging pipe, a fixing strip is fixedly arranged in the bell mouth, and the fan is fixedly arranged in the bell mouth through the fixing strip. By means of the structural design, when the fan rotates, the flow speed at one end of the horn mouth accelerates the pressure to reduce, so that the smoke in the top cover and the barrel flows outwards through the smoke exhaust pipe, the smoke is prevented from being diffused in a ward, and the workload of doctors is increased.

Detailed Description
The present utility model will be described in detail below with reference to the drawings and the specific embodiments, wherein like or similar parts are designated by the same reference numerals throughout the drawings or the description, and implementations not shown or described in the drawings are in a form well known to those of ordinary skill in the art. In addition, directional terms such as "upper", "lower", "top", "bottom", "left", "right", "front", "rear", etc. in the embodiments are merely directions with reference to the drawings, and are not intended to limit the scope of the present utility model.
As shown in figures 1-5, the scald preventing barrier moxibustion tool comprises a barrel 1, wherein a top cover 2 is arranged at the upper end of the barrel 1, a fixing needle 3 for fixing moxa sticks is fixedly arranged at the bottom of the top cover 2, an air inlet hole 4 is formed in the lower part of the barrel 1, interlayers are respectively arranged in the barrel 1 and the top cover 2 and are communicated with each other, a through hole 5 communicated with the interlayer of the barrel 1 is formed in the inner wall of the barrel 1, a barrier layer 6 for placing medicines is arranged at the lower part of the barrel 1, and a smoke exhausting mechanism 7 for guiding air in the barrel 1 and the top cover 2 outwards is arranged at the upper end of the top cover 2.
A plurality of suckers 11 are evenly and fixedly arranged at the lower end of the cylinder body 1.
The inside of the cylinder 1 is provided with spun yarn fireproof cloth 12.
The upper end cover of barrel 1 is equipped with silk cover 21, and fixed mounting has connecting cylinder 22 on the top cap 2, and the inside of connecting cylinder 22 is equipped with the internal thread, and connecting cylinder 22 and silk cover 21 threaded connection, the top of top cap 2 rotates installs handle 23.
The isolation layer 6 comprises a storage disc 61 and a push-pull block 62, a chute is transversely arranged at the lower part of the cylinder body 1, the storage disc 61 is slidably arranged in the chute, the storage disc 61 consists of a fixed frame sliding in the chute and a fixed net for placing medicines, and the push-pull block 62 is fixedly arranged on the fixed frame.
The cylinder body 1 is fixedly provided with a fixed column 63, the fixed column 63 is rotatably provided with a rotating strip 64, and the rotating strip 64 is contacted with the object placing disc 61.
The smoke exhausting mechanism 7 comprises a movable iron cover 72, a smoke exhausting pipe 73, a horn mouth 74 and a fan 76, a round hole is formed in the top of the top cover 2, a ring magnet 71 is fixedly arranged at the top of the top cover 2 and located right above the round hole, the movable iron cover 72 is movably arranged on the ring magnet 71, the smoke exhausting pipe 73 is fixedly arranged on the movable iron cover 72, the smoke exhausting pipe 73 is communicated with the movable iron cover 72, the horn mouth 74 is fixedly arranged at one end, far away from the movable iron cover 72, of the smoke exhausting pipe 73, a fixing strip 75 is fixedly arranged in the horn mouth 74, and the fan 76 is fixedly arranged in the horn mouth 74 through the fixing strip 75.
In this embodiment, when in use, the rotating bar 64 is shifted to one side, so that the rotating bar 64 releases the contact relationship with the object placing disc 61, the object placing disc 61 is pulled by the push-pull block 62 to separate the object placing disc 61 from the cylinder 1, after the medicine is placed on the object placing disc 61, the object placing disc 61 is pushed into the cylinder 1, and the rotating bar 64 is rotated, so that the rotating bar 64 contacts with the object placing disc 61;
rotating the top cover 2, taking the top cover 2 off the upper end of the cylinder 1, enabling the fixing needle 3 to be inserted into the moxa cone, igniting the moxa cone after fixing the moxa cone, and rotating the top cover 2 again to recover the threaded connection relation between the top cover 2 and the cylinder 1;
the cylinder 1 is pressed downwards, so that air in the sucker 11 is discharged, and under the action of pressure, the sucker 11 is tightly attached to the skin of a patient, and the cylinder 1 is fixed on the patient;
the movable iron cover 72 is covered to the top center of the top cover 2, the annular magnet 71 generates magnetic adsorption force on the movable iron cover 72, the movable iron cover 72 is fixed on the top cover 2, at the moment, one end of the horn mouth 74 is placed at a ward window, when the fan 76 rotates, the flow speed of one end of the horn mouth 74 is accelerated, the pressure intensity is reduced, the flue gas in the top cover 2 and the cylinder body 1 flows outwards through the smoke exhaust pipe 73, and the flue gas is prevented from being diffused in the ward.
